I get that it confuses people... we parade around in bikinis and six inch heels and people often wonder if that is actually  the best way to judge our lifestyles. If you don't do or watch pageants regularly, I can see how that would be confusing or even troubling. In June, I had the pleasure of spending six days with 15 other beautiful contestants as we all continued our journey to Miss Iowa 2015. I've said it before and I'll say it again: these women are the most intelligent, selfless, hilarious, kind women I have ever known, and just being associated with them is an honor. For those not familiar with the Miss America Organization, we participate in five areas of competition. Talent, evening gown, onstage question, a ten minute private interview with the judging panel, and lifestyle and fitness in swimsuit.
